When’s the Best Time for Pregnant Woman Photos?

Timing is everything, folks. Most photographers recommend taking pregnant woman photos between 32 and 36 weeks of pregnancy. Why? Because by then, your belly is beautifully rounded, but you’re not too far along to feel uncomfortable. Plus, you’ll still have enough energy to pose like a queen.

Of course, every pregnancy is different. If you’re feeling great earlier or later, don’t stress. The key is to listen to your body and schedule the session when you feel your best. After all, confidence shines through in every photo.

Factors to Consider When Choosing the Right Time

  • Energy levels: Are you feeling energized or exhausted? Go for it when you feel like a superhero.
  • Belly size: A well-rounded belly makes for some killer shots, but it’s all about what feels right for you.
  • Comfort: If you’re starting to feel like a beached whale, it might be time to reconsider the timing.

Working with a Professional Photographer

Let’s be real—while your partner or best friend might take some cute snapshots, hiring a professional photographer can elevate your photos to the next level. They bring expertise, creativity, and a keen eye for detail that can truly make your photos stand out.

When choosing a photographer, look for someone who specializes in maternity photography. Ask to see their portfolio, read reviews, and don’t hesitate to ask questions. After all, this is a big investment, and you want to make sure you’re working with someone who understands your vision.

Questions to Ask Your Photographer

  • What’s your style? Do you prefer posed shots or candid moments?
  • Do you offer retouching services? How much editing do you do?
  • What’s included in the package? Are prints, digital files, or albums available?

DIY Pregnant Woman Photos: Can You Do It Yourself?

Not everyone has the budget for a professional photographer, and that’s okay. With a good camera, some creativity, and a little help from your partner or a friend, you can still capture amazing pregnant woman photos. The key is to experiment and have fun with it.

Here are a few tips to keep in mind: use natural lighting whenever possible, find a simple but beautiful background, and don’t be afraid to get creative with poses. And remember, it’s not about perfection—it’s about capturing the essence of this special time in your life.

DIY Photography Tips

  • Use natural light: Golden hour (an hour after sunrise or before sunset) is your best friend.
  • Keep it simple: A clean background helps your subject stand out.
  • Experiment with angles: Don’t be afraid to try different perspectives.
